Allow symptomatic health professionals the coronavirus test
Rejected
21 signatures
What the petition asks
Allow symptomatic health professionals to have the coronavirus test even if no direct contact. Presently they can only have the test if they returned from a high risk area or had direct contact with a case.
10% of Italian doctors are infected. Testing health professionals who are sick with high fever etc is necessary to protect their patients, colleagues and families and in order to maintain NHS business continuity. These doctors may have been on the tube, at mass gatherings etc. This is a ticking time bomb but the government has a chance to mitigate damage by acting NOW!!!
Why it was rejected
It asked for something that is not the responsibility of the UK Government or Parliament.
Testing is a clinical decision for the NHS, not the UK Government or Parliament.
